What Does a Casino SEO Agency Actually Do for Your Gaming Site?

A casino SEO agency works beyond basic keyword stuffing, engineering your site’s architecture so search engines can crawl and index every game page, bonus tier, and live dealer lobby with precision. It performs deep technical audits—fixing page speed, mobile responsiveness, and duplicate content issues—while building a backlink profile from gambling-specific directories and affiliate communities that carry real authority. Crucially, it optimizes for transactional intent, targeting phrases like “real money roulette” or “no deposit bonus codes” that convert visitors into depositors. The agency also restructures internal linking to push link equity toward high-commission pages, and it rewrites metadata and on-page copy to match the language of seasoned players. Yet, the real value lies in its ability to prioritize pages that actually rank, not just traffic. Ultimately, it aligns every SEO action with your revenue model, ensuring organic visibility drives sign-ups rather than vanity clicks.

How They Tackle Technical Audits for High-Competition Niches

In high-competition casino niches, their technical audits go beyond crawl errors, prioritizing **core web vitals and indexation efficiency** under aggressive throttling. They simulate Googlebot with regional proxies to expose geo-blocked assets, then strip render-blocking JavaScript that delays slot-page loading. Canonical chains are compressed to one authoritative URL per game cluster, while internal anchor text is rewritten to match commercial intent for high-value terms like “live dealer bonus.” They also audit schema markup for missing Game and Offer types, ensuring rich snippets survive algorithm updates. The audit concludes with a prioritization matrix—fixing leaks that waste crawl budget first, not cosmetic HTML issues.

How does a technical audit differ for a competitive casino niche? It focuses on speed and crawl efficiency versus competitor domains, not just baseline compliance. They parse server logs to identify where Googlebot spends time, then purge thin aggregation pages to push equity toward money pages. This forensic approach prevents the “spider trap” that plagues large gaming portals.

Link Building Strategies Tailored to the Casino Sector

In the casino sector, generic directories and mass-produced guest posts are worthless; a specialized agency must secure links from gambling-adjacent niches like tech reviews, game mathematics forums, and high-roller lifestyle blogs. The core difference is contextual relevance paired with strict authority vetting, since casino backlinks demand a higher editorial bar than typical e-commerce. You build digital PR around proprietary tools, like RTP calculators or slot volatility trackers, to earn natural citations from affiliate sites. Additionally, exploiting broken link profiles of defunct casino portals offers a fast, targeted win. Every anchor text must be blended with brand and naked URLs to avoid algorithmic penalties.

  • Pursue links from igaming software review sites and comparison platforms.
  • Reclaim unlinked brand mentions across casino forums and news roundups.
  • Create data-driven infographics on payout trends to attract editorial backlinks.

Typical Timelines for On-Page Fixes Versus Authority Building

On-page fixes from a casino SEO agency typically show measurable movement within 4–8 weeks, as technical corrections, meta-data rewrites, and content restructuring are indexed and re-crawled. Authority building, however, operates on a 6–12 month curve, because link acquisition and brand signals require gradual accumulation. The logical sequence is:

  1. audit and implement on-page changes (weeks 1–4)
  2. observe ranking volatility and indexation (weeks 5–8)
  3. launch outreach and digital PR for backlinks (months 3–6)
  4. consolidate gains via content silos and internal linking (months 7–12)

The gap between quick wins and sustainable rankings is where most casinos lose patience, yet on-page fixes alone plateau without authority. For a casino SEO agency, the authority-building phase is the non-negotiable bottleneck that determines whether short-term fixes convert into long-term market share.

How to Spot Meaningful Progress vs. Vanity Numbers in Your Dashboard

In your casino SEO dashboard, meaningful progress appears as organic sessions that convert into real player registrations or deposit events, not raw clicks alone. Track keyword rankings for transactional terms like “real money slots” or “live dealer bonus” rather than broad informational phrases that inflate your totals. A vanity number is a jump in page views without a corresponding lift in goal completions; a useful metric is the conversion rate from landing pages to sign-ups. Also, monitor search console impressions against average position—climbing positions for high-intent queries signal authority, while increased impressions for low-relevance terms do not. Compare month-over-month revenue-attributed sessions to separate true growth from seasonal noise.

Ignore traffic spikes that don’t produce player actions; focus on keyword-intent shifts and revenue-linked conversions as your casino SEO compass.

Why Relying on Outdated Tactics Gets Your Domain Penalized

Outdated tactics like mass directory submissions, exact-match anchor overdrive, or private blog network (PBN) footprints trigger Penguin-style filters that deindex your casino domain instantly. Search engines now read link velocity and contextual relevance; a sudden spike from spammy gambling portals signals manipulation, not authority. Your casino seo agency must purge old link profiles and replace them with geo-targeted, player-intent content that earns natural citations. Stale keyword stuffing also dilutes semantic clarity, while cloaked redirects from legacy campaigns get manually reviewed. Penalties compound: lost rankings, revoked ad accounts, and reduced crawl budget. A modern audit should identify toxic backlinks, obsolete schema, and thin doorway pages before Google does.

  • Legacy PBNs leave identifiable CMS and hosting fingerprints.
  • Exact-match anchors from 2015 trigger spam filters today.
  • Doorway pages for old bonus codes create duplicate content flags.
  • No link reclamation means your profile decays faster than competitors.
